Private Victor Edward Bogert

top

PERSONAL INFORMATION

Date of birth: 1897-05-26
Place of birth: Inkster North Dakota U.S.A.
Next of kin: John Edward Bogert, father, of Enderby, British Columbia
Marital status: single
Occupation (attested): Farmer
Occupation (normalized): General Farmer
Address: Enderby, British Columbia
Religion: Methodist
Date of death: 1918-06-27
Cause of death: Died of wounds

MILITARY INFORMATION

Regimental number: 688168
Highest Rank: Private (29th Battalion)
Rank detail
  1. Private, 29th Battalion, Infantry (Army).
  2. Private (Army).
  3. Private, 54th Battalion, Infantry (Army).
Degree of service: Europe
Survived war: no
Battle wounded/killed: wounded April 9, 1917. Second wound June 26, 1918 - died from same.
Awards

Military Medal
Date of award: 1917-04-03
Source: London Gazette 30064 R.O. 1146 Byng
